Barcelona is a Spanish city and capital of the Autonomous Community of Catalonia. Located on the shores of the Mediterranean Sea, about 120 km south of the Pyrenees mountain range and has been the scene of many world events.
Nowadays, Barcelona is recognized as a global city for its cultural, financial, trade and tourism.

Logroño was first settled in the fourth century on monte de Cantabria (Mount Cantabria), which dominates the city today from the left bank of the river. Celtiberian settlements were established within the walled district before these strongholds were destroyed by Liuvigild in 575. In the sixth century, the city was established in what is now Logroño. Later on, in the eleventh century, the capital of the Rioja consolidated its importance through two major events: the code of law or charter of Alfonso VI and the development of the Camino de Santiago (Way of St. James). Over subsequent centuries, the city would develop its trade – wine production and river fishing – under the strong influence of the church and militia, which played an important role in urban life. During this period, the Plaza del Mercado (“Market Square”), also known as Plaza de Herventía, became popular as a meeting point for merchants and market stallholders. This is why the square is one of the most obvious sites for hosting culture and leisure events today.

Today, a local guide will escort us on our visit to the only region of La Rioja on the left bank of the Ebro River, with towns that don’t have more than a thousand inhabitants and surrounded by vineyards. In the village of Briñas stand out the noble houses of S. XVI and XVII, the Plaza Mayor Fountain and the Church of the Assumption. From there we’ll go to San Vicente de la Sonsierra, where is located the castle of XII century. We will also visit the Church of Santa María, great example of the Rioja Romanesque. After this, we’ll go to Ábalos, where stands the Palace of the Marqueses de Legarda.
We’ll continue to Nájera, where during the afternoon we’ll visit the Monastery of Santa María la Real, the pantheon of the Kings of Navarra, in flamboyant Gothic style and where stands the cloister of the Knights (Claustro de los Caballeros).
